Patent number: 10131821Abstract: One or more cuts is provided in a label liner sheet near the area of a cutout within the label, such as the center hole in a CD label, in order to facilitate reliable separation of the cutout from the label and retention of the cutout on the liner sheet as the label is peeled from the liner. The majority of the cut runs generally parallel to the cutout boundary underneath the cutout, and the ends of the cut cross the boundary at two separate boundary crossing points on either side of the portion of the cut running parallel to the boundary. The cut first causes a flap to be created in the liner sheet and partially lifted as the label is beginning to be peeled away. Thereafter, as the peel line passes the flap area, the cutout experiences the full retentive strength of the label's pressure sensitive adhesive primarily at the two boundary crossings, and the cutout is pulled from the label and retained on the liner sheet as the adhesive force overcomes the cohesive force.Type: GrantFiled: December 29, 2017Date of Patent: November 20, 2018Assignee: CCL Label, Inc.Inventor: Jerry G. Patent number: 8455073Abstract: A label sheet construction including a liner sheet and a facestock sheet releasably adhered to the liner sheet. A plurality of labels and fold lines are die cut in the facestock sheet but not the liner sheet. The fold lines extend between the labels. After the sheet construction has been passed through a printer or copier and the desired indicia printed on the labels, the construction (an upper portion thereof) is bent back along one of the fold lines. This separates a(n) (upper) portion of the label from the underlying liner sheet. The user then easily grasps the upper portion and peels the label off of the liner sheet without tearing the label. When the label has a burst design, it is preferable to have a pair of fold lines for folding the liner sheet away from a portion of the label. The burst design preferably has alternating long and short points.Type: GrantFiled: October 14, 2009Date of Patent: June 4, 2013Assignee: Avery Dennison CorporationInventors: Jerry G.
